Abstract
Chemically reduced graphene oxide (rGO) decorated with aliphatic dendrimers having gold nanoparticles either in their endo- or exo-positions was firstly formulated through fully noncovalent functionalization approaches. Noncovalent binding of aliphatic denchimers specifically on rGO rather than on graphene oxide (GO) could be clearly visualized in transmission electron microscopy analysis.
